Egg in a Bagel Recipe

Description:

Lunchtime is about to get an upgrade with this protein-packed Egg in a Bagel recipe. Quick to make, this delicious lunch option will keep you satiated until dinner. The creamy Kerry gold Spreadable, sourced from Irish farms, adds a rich, distinctive flavor to this dish.

Servings: 4
Preparation Time: 10 minutes
Cooking Time: 15 minutes
Total Time: 25 minutes

Ingredients:

  • 45g Kerrygold Spreadable
  • 4 sesame bagels
  • 4 tbsp tomato relish
  • 200g sliced ham
  • 4 medium eggs
  • 1 ripe avocado, sliced
  • 50g of rocket (arugula)

Instructions:

  1. Preparation:
  • Preheat your oven to 180°C (fan setting). Ensure you have a large baking sheet lined with parchment paper ready.

2. Bagel Bases:

  • Begin by toasting the bases of the bagels.
  • Once toasted, spread them generously with Kerrygold Spreadable.
  • Layer the relish and sliced ham atop the spread.

3. Bagel Tops with Egg:

  • Butter the cut side of the bagel tops and place them on the prepared baking sheet.
  • Carefully crack an egg into the hole of each bagel top.
  • Transfer the bagels to the oven and bake for 15 minutes, or until the eggs are set.

4. Combine and Serve:

  • Around the 10-minute mark, add the bagel bases to the oven tray.
  • After the eggs have set, take the bagels out of the oven.
  • Place slices of avocado and rocket atop the ham on the base of the bagels.
  • Carefully position the egg-topped bagel half onto its corresponding base.
  • Serve immediately and enjoy!

Pro Tips:

  • For a bit of a kick, add some hot sauce or spicy mayo to the bagel.
  • This recipe is versatile – you can add other ingredients such as cheese, bacon, or sautéed mushrooms based on your preference.
